Best ForContent-driven SEO teams managing multiple verticals or topical clusters, Enterprise marketing organizations with high content production volume, In-house teams seeking to reduce reliance on external SEO agenciesEnterprise teams, SEO workflows
Top StrengthContent gap analysis identifies specific missing topics and subtopics competitors rank for, giving precise direction for new content rather than generic keyword lists.Unmatched competitive intelligence depth with Sensor alerts, competitor backlink tracking, and market share analysis across industries and geographies
Main LimitationSteep learning curve for teams unfamiliar with content intelligence concepts; requires dedicated user training and often a content strategist to interpret recommendations effectively.Steep learning curve and feature bloat; many teams underutilize 60-70% of available tools, making the platform feel unnecessarily complex for focused use cases

Is AI-generated content good for SEO?

AI-generated content can be good for SEO when it's high-quality, original, and human-reviewed, but Google penalizes low-quality, thin AI content. The key is using AI as a writing assistant rather than a replacement for human expertise. Most successful SEO strategies combine AI efficiency with human editorial oversight.

Can AI write blog posts that rank on Google?

Yes, AI can write blog posts that rank on Google, but only with significant human oversight. AI-generated content ranks best when it's fact-checked, includes original research or data, targets specific search intent, and is edited for expertise and accuracy. Google's 2024 guidance prioritizes E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ness) over the tool used to create content.

What is AI topic clustering for SEO?

AI topic clustering is a machine learning technique that groups related keywords and content themes into semantic clusters, helping SEOs build topically relevant content pillars and improve search rankings. It identifies relationships between topics that traditional keyword research misses, enabling more strategic content planning around 5-15 related subtopics per pillar.
